Comprehensive Definitions & Senses

2 senses
As adjective
  1. 1

    Practical, reasonable, and friendly; possessing a sensible and unpretentious attitude.

    "Despite her immense success as an actress, she remains remarkably down-to-earth and easy to talk to."
  2. 2

    Direct, realistic, and firmly based on observable facts or reality.

    "The manager offered a down-to-earth assessment of the company's financial challenges."

Linguistic Origin & Historical Etymology

Originating in early 20th-century English, the term draws a direct metaphorical comparison to the solid, unpretentious earth beneath our feet. Initially used in agricultural and physical contexts, it evolved by the mid-1900s to describe individuals who are practical, realistic, and free from pretense or lofty delusions.
